Bruxism, Periodontitis, Sleep Bruxism
Conditions
Brief summary
This study aims to investigate the association between periodontitis Stage III and IV and the intensity and duration of sleep bruxism episodes. Surface electromyography (EMG) of the masseter muscle will be used to instrumentally assess sleep bruxism in patients with and without periodontal disease
Detailed description
The purpose of this cross-sectional study is to evaluate whether patients with Stage III and IV periodontitis exhibit differences in sleep bruxism activity compared to individuals without periodontal disease. Participants will undergo comprehensive periodontal assessment and 24-hour EMG recording of the masseter muscle using a portable device. Bruxism activity will be quantified using the Bruxism Work Index (BWI) and Bruxism Time Index (BTI). The study aims to clarify the potential relationship between periodontal inflammation and masticatory muscle activity during sleep, following standardized diagnostic and recording protocols
Interventions
Participants will undergo 24-hour surface electromyographic recording of the left masseter muscle using the dia-BRUXO portable device to quantify sleep bruxism activity through Bruxism Work Index (BWI) and Bruxism Time Index (BTI).

Eligibility
Inclusion criteria
* Age between 28 and 50 years * Ability to perform adequate oral hygiene * Willingness to participate and sign informed consent * For periodontitis group: Diagnosis of Stage III or IV periodontitis * For control group: Absence of periodontal disease
Exclusion criteria
* Use of removable dentures * Ongoing orthodontic treatment * Temporomandibular disorders (TMD) or orofacial pain * Use of medications affecting muscle activity * Systemic or psychiatric disorders * Diabetes
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Sleep Bruxism Work Index (BWI) | Within 24 hours after EMG device application | BWI is calculated as the percentage of muscle work exerted during bruxism-related masticatory activity relative to the theoretical maximum work. It will be used to assess the intensity of sleep bruxism based on EMG recordings of the masseter muscle |
